Dealing with Contaminated Floodwater in Your Jamestown Home

Natural flooding exposes your Jamestown home to many potential hazards and health risks that make it unsafe for your family to remain in the property until restoration work has completed. With the unknown paths that floodwaters can take to reach your home, many potential contaminants could exist in this invading water that spreads bacteria and other harmful substances throughout the structure and contents of the house. As much as you might want to handle the assessment of the flood damage to your Jamestown home on your own, the risk for contamination is considerable with natural flooding, and it is inadvisable to do so. Our SERVPRO professionals arrive with the full measure of our personal protective equipment to wear as we set up the machines for extraction. This step is a vital component to preparing your home for the debris removal and cleanup efforts that it requires.

Once extraction has completed throughout the exposed areas of your property, our estimator and project manager can begin an assessment of the damage and what exposed elements must get removed. With black water flooding, nearly all of the exposed materials and construction elements must get removed to eliminate the potential for continued spread of bacteria, chemicals, and other harmful contaminants to the occupants of the household.

We prepare your home for the reconstruction it requires following a disaster like this with effective debris removal. When we reach structural elements like studs and beams, we can work to disinfect and clean these components to prevent further demolition. We can also spray these areas with an antimicrobial solution to make them uninhabitable to mold growth, which can happen quickly in this moist environment.
